La Defense, the modern district of Paris. I’ve been there in 2009 and I was delighted with the contrast… the classic and romantic Paris from one side and the business one from the other and so close. The name is a tribute to the soldiers who fought for France in World War II. Today we would think that this name also could be to defend the money, because La Defense is the biggest financial center from Europe.
Driving to Chicama at the midway. The path is a moonscape desert, sometimes some vegetation, high mountains touching the clouds with lots of rocks and boulders. The mountains close to the roads have big stones that can’t roll, because there is no rain, wind or storms in this place.

Go up on Eiffel Tower early in the morning is the best hour to avoid lines. Besides see the horizon, you should look at downward and watch the parisian’s routine at Champ de Mars. Choose a sunny day and get ready for the cold weather, if you go in the winter like me.
Urubici is the highest point in Santa Catarina and It already registered the lowest degree in the country, -17,8ºC in 1996. It was in the morning, before leaving for a trail at 7:40 PM, that I had the pleasure of taking this photo when the city was hidden by a fog typical from the region. It seemed like I was on clouds.
